'Bond King' Bill Gross is retiring

ThisIsinsider.com 

  • "Bond King" Bill Gross is retiring from the financial industry after more than 40 years.
  • Gross founded Pimco and served as the firm's managing director and chief investment officer. 
  • He left Pimco for Janus Henderson in 2014.
  • Gross says he plans on working with charitable organizations in retirement.

Bill Gross, once know as the "Bond King," is retiring after more than 40 years in the financial industry.
